Second Chance Wildlife Center: What to KnowIf you find an injured, sick, or orphaned wild animal, there’s now a dedicated place to turn. The Second Chance Wildlife Center in Clarksburg is officially Maryland’s first and only licensed veterinary hospital exclusively for wildlife.  The Center treats more than 2,500 animals each year, including birds, small mammals, and reptiles, and is open for patient admissions daily from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m., including weekends and holidays.   What you should do:  Do not attempt to treat or keep wildlife yourself. Limit handling and keep the animal in a quiet, secure container. Montgomery County Economic Development SurveyThe public has a chance to weigh in on the 2026 Countywide Strategic Plan. The Public Input Survey is open now. In 2021, the Montgomery County Council passed a law designating the Montgomery County Economic Development Corporation to lead the development of a countywide economic development strategic plan. Updated every four years, the plan serves as a roadmap to align economic development efforts, drive business growth and job creation, strengthen the talent pipeline, and advance long-term economic resilience and competitiveness for the County.Economic development is more than business growth. Nation’s Largest Transit Depot Microgrid Montgomery County Executive Marc Elrich, Lt. Gov. Aruna Miller, County Council Vice President Marilyn Balcombe, AlphaStruxure, and federal, state, and local officials today announced the successful completion of the largest transit depot microgrid in the nation at the County’s David F. Bone Equipment Maintenance and Transit Operation Center (EMTOC) in Derwood.
